About Sebastián Sánchez

Sebastián Sánchez is a scholar working on Hardware and Architecture, Software and Radiation, having authored 75 papers that have together received 447 indexed citations. Recurring topics across this work include Real-Time Systems Scheduling (20 papers), Solar and Space Plasma Dynamics (11 papers) and Radiation Effects in Electronics (11 papers). The work is most often cited by research in Hardware and Architecture (98 citations), Astronomy and Astrophysics (163 citations) and Radiation (68 citations). Sebastián Sánchez has collaborated with scholars based in Spain, United States and Ukraine. Frequent co-authors include D. Meziat, Óscar R. Polo, Manuel Prieto, J. Medina, Jesús Tabero, L. del Peral, J. Sequeiros, H. Sierks, P. Rusznyak and R. Müller‐Mellin. Their work appears in journals such as IEEE Transactions on Aerospace and Electronic Systems, Nuclear Instruments and Methods in Physics Research Section A Accelerators Spectrometers Detectors and Associated Equipment and IEEE Transactions on Nuclear Science.
